MegaManFan #13 Posted April 25, 2003 what are expantion packs? not familiar with 64s They go in a little notch area on the top of the N64, basically if you have one in it already it's seamless and you wouldn't even know you DIDN'T have one (I bought Donkey Kong 64 loose and it worked, so I didn't realize it). They're usually red, at least the Nintendo brand (I don't know if there are any third party variations). Gives the N64 a "boost" of memory, possibly processing ability too (but I'm not sure about that). I know Perfect Dark requires it for the "full version" of the game too.
